The major league baseball season is one week old and the White Sox are leading the AL Central. Not only that but they took two out of three games from the Indians (the chic pick) and the Twins (the three time defending champs) during opening week. I know it's early, but things are looking promising for the South Siders.

Things haven't been so rosy for the Marlins so far, but they're at .500 and Beckett and Willis (all of the pitching staff really) has looked great.

The Hurricanes swept Virginia Tech in baseball over the weekend. That was something that should have been a given going into the weekend, but given the Canes struggles to date this year, it wasn't. Still, it was good to beat the Hokies in something this year at least. Maybe it's a sign of things to come for football.

Speaking of football, I made it out to the Spring Game on Saturday. I got this impression when I attended practice one day this Spring, but the game solidified it: James Bryant is going to revolutionize the fullback position at the University of Miami. He seems to take joy in hitting people. And he has pretty good hands too. He's going to be fun to watch.
